What is a float variable?
A floating point type variable is a variable that can hold a real number, such as 4320.0, -3.33, or 0.01226. The floating part of the name floating point refers to the fact that the decimal point can “float”; that is, it can support a variable number of digits before and after the decimal point.

What is a float vs Double?
FloatDoubleSingle precision valueDouble precision valueCan store Up to 7 significant digitsStores up to 15 significant digitsOccupies 4 bytes of memory (32 bits IEEE 754)Occupies 8 bytes of memory (64-bits IEEE 754)Why does Unity use floats instead of doubles?
Unity internally uses a double to track time. The double is converted to a float before being passed to user code. This is largely because Unity uses floats in most other locations (floats are much better supported on a range of graphics cards/platforms).
What is difference between float and double in C++?Double is more precise than float and can store 64 bits; double the number of bits float can store. We prefer double over float if we need to do precision up to 15 or 16 decimal points; otherwise, we can stick to float in most applications, as double is more expensive.

How is a float stored?
Scalars of type float are stored using four bytes (32-bits). The format used follows the IEEE-754 standard. The mantissa represents the actual binary digits of the floating-point number. … The stored form of the exponent is an 8-bit value from 0 to 255.

How do float and decimal types compare?
Float stores an approximate value and decimal stores an exact value. In summary, exact values like money should use decimal, and approximate values like scientific measurements should use float.
